Shell替换上一条命令中的字符串
2015-01-05 19:28
218 查看
今天学到了一个shell技巧:替换上一条执行过的命令中的字符串。
示例如下
解释一下:
首先执行
然后输入
示例如下
~/tmp$ ls d.cpio d.cpio ~/tmp$ ^cpio^tar ls d.tar d.tar
解释一下:
首先执行
ls d.cpio
然后输入
^cpio^tar把
ls d.cpio中的cpio替换成tar,然后执行替换后的命令。
相关文章推荐
- Shell 小技巧的问题 mysql -e ,字符串替换telnet命令检测
- 在shell中,拼接一个字符串,形成一条命令
- 使用shell命令sed将指定目录下的所有文件中指定的字符串替换成指定的字符串
- 一条命令批量替换多个文件中字符串
- shell脚本中使用tr命令实现对字符串删除、替换和赋值
- shell ,sed命令用变量替换字符串,单引号改为双引号
- [Linux]:Bash shell字符串截取及命令替换
- Shell: 变量替换 命令替换 & ~波浪号替换的区别
- 在WinDBG中, 使用.shell命令来搜索字符串
- Shell命令中的扩展和替换
- 一条命令操作shell清空缓存
- Shell命令 参数 字符串连接
- vi中的字符串替换命令
- VI中的替换命令和shell中的正则表达式
- shell 字符串操作(长度,查找,替换)详解
- shell 字符串操作(长度,查找,替换)详解
- shell下数字和字符串比较操作命令
- vi/vim 中可以使用 :s 命令来替换字符串。
- 用shell替换文件中的字符串
- sed 命令替换多个文件中的某个字符串